Abstract

Abstract Data logged on mineral benefIclation processes during normal operation are analysed using time series (correlation and spectral) methods to identify the dynamics of the processes for on-line cotaputer control. Recursive least squares estimation techniques are used to identify parametric oodels for a cassiterite flotation circuit and a coal uashery. Identification problem such as the determination of model order, process time delays and the ‘contamination’ of the data by process recycle streams (feedback) are dlscusscd. Typical results are presented in which optimised models are identified from data logged during normal operation.
